Green Tech & Sustainable Innovation – Shaping a Cleaner Future

Introduction

Green technology is driving sustainable innovation across industries, helping reduce environmental impact while boosting efficiency. From renewable energy to eco‑friendly materials, businesses are embracing solutions that align with global sustainability goals.

Why Green Tech Matters

  • Climate Action: Reduces greenhouse gas emissions and supports global climate targets.
  • Cost Savings: Energy‑efficient systems lower operational expenses.
  • Consumer Demand: Eco‑conscious customers prefer sustainable brands.
  • Regulatory Compliance: Meets stricter environmental standards worldwide.

Key Innovations

  • Smart Grids: Balance renewable energy supply with demand.
  • Eco‑Materials: Biodegradable plastics and sustainable packaging reduce waste.
  • Electric Mobility: EVs and charging infrastructure cut reliance on fossil fuels.
  • Carbon Capture: Technologies that trap and store emissions from industrial processes.

Advantages

  • Strengthens brand reputation as eco‑friendly.
  • Attracts investment and government incentives.
  • Improves long‑term resilience against resource scarcity.

Risks

  • High upfront costs for green technologies.
  • Slow adoption in regions with limited infrastructure.
  • Technical challenges in scaling innovations globally.
